## v4.8.0 — Changed defaults

Firmware update channel for Lumawire devices now defaults to "stable" instead of "beta". Too many field units pulled untested builds after provisioning; the Korvano fleet incident made this unavoidable. Devices already pinned to a channel are untouched. Rollback: set channel explicitly in the provisioning profile. Note the updater daemon re-reads channel config only on reboot, not on SIGHUP — known limitation, tracked separately. The new effective defaults shipped with this release are as follows.

service settings:
druael:
  log_level: error
  metrics_host: metrics.druael.tolvaqlabs.internal
  pool_size: 16

Ticket #88: Badge system migration, night-shift notice. Over the weekend, Fenwick Row is moving from the old Keystone readers to the new Ardale panels. Night staff should expect the lift lobby readers to be offline between 01:00 and 04:00 on Saturday. During this window, use the stairwell doors only, and log every entry in the paper register at the guard desk. Legacy badges will stop working once the cutover completes. Until your replacement badge arrives, the night crew should use the interim code below.

door code, yageg-yagap: bdg-DNN-9

**Ceremony item — Fanout backpressure key**

☐ Rotate the throttle-config signing key for the Skeinly notification fan-out tier. Confirm backpressure limits still load after rotation and queue lag stays under threshold for 15 minutes. Archive the prior key offline. The archive bundle decrypts with the passphrase below.

unlock words, bafof-hahof: druael-ralwyn